This article will walk through some of the configuration options within MiNiFi CPP. As discussed in the Readme, MiNiFi C++ is configured through two files, a config YAML file that includes the flow configuration and general properties for the MiNiFi process. . Users can use the MiNiFi toolkit converter to help create flow configurations from a template exported from a NiFi instance. This document will assume that the YAML configuration will be generated by the toolkit. The Flow Configuration Options section, below, provides some information on each section within the flow configuration file. Note that the examples below are taken from the Github Readme file. Flow Configuration options
Processors
Processors are defined within the YAML configuration, below. You must specify the number of concurrent tasks, the scheduling strategy, the NiFi class and properties, if there are any to define.The id is a unique identifier
that must be defined for each processor. When specifying connections, you will reference the success relationships and this identifier as either the source and/or destination ID.

Provenance Reporting
To add Provenance Reporting to config.yml, define a configuration block like the one below. Define your RPG host, port, and UUID using
the Site To Site protocol. The batch size will limit the number of provenance reports that are sent to the aforementioned NiFi instance.

Controller Services
If you need to reference a controller service in your config.yml file, use the following template. In the example, below, ControllerServiceClass is the name of the class defining the controller Service. ControllerService1 is linked to ControllerService2, and requires the latter to be started for ControllerService1 to start.
